      Mito HollyHock had a mediocre start to the new season. They secured 1 win, 1 draw, and 1 loss in the first three league games, accumulating 4 points and currently sitting in 7th place. However, the team has faced setbacks recently. In the mid - week Emperor's Cup, Mito HollyHock made significant lineup rotations, but still suffered a shocking 0 - 2 home defeat to the amateur side Kyoto Sangyo University and were eliminated. This loss has dealt a blow to the team's morale and performance. On the other hand, Machida Zelvia has shown championship - level dominance this season. They've achieved three consecutive wins at the start of the league, amassing 9 points and leading the standings. Their offensive and defensive stats are extremely impressive, scoring 12 goals and conceding only 2 in the first three rounds.
